Title: The Lesson in Humility
Name: Christopher Jouan
Country: USA
Software: Painter, Photoshop
This piece took nearly 2 years to complete because I couldn't decide how to approach the viewpoint. The only element that did not change was the carrier.
Sometimes we're so involved with our own "greatness" that we don't realize there might be others bigger and greater out there. My hope is that whomever they may be, they would be advanced enough to understand that we're still a bunch of tribes trying to work out our differences.
(Granted, tribes with the ability to wipe ourselves off the face of the planet without any help.)
Perhaps by simply showing how advanced they are, we might learn a thing or two about humility.
